• DocumentCode
    2170352
  • Title

    A parallel LTE Turbo decoder on GPU

  • Author

    Chengjun Liu ; Zhisong Bie ; Canfeng Chen ; Xianjun Jiao

  • Author_Institution
    Key Lab. of Universal Wireless Commun., Minist. of Educ., Beijing Univ. of Posts & Telecommun., Beijing, China
  • fYear
    2013
  • fDate
    17-19 Nov. 2013
  • Firstpage
    609
  • Lastpage
    614
  • Abstract
    Turbo codes were developed by Claude Berrou in 1993, which were based on convolutional codes and Viterbi algorithm and could closely approach the channel capacity. Software Defined Radio (SDR) promises to revolutionize the communication industry by delivering low-cost, flexible software solutions. Graphics Processing Units (GPUs) offer unprecedented application performance since they have many cores. GPUs have been widely used to accelerate a wide range of applications. In this paper, a 3GPP LTE Turbo decoder on GPU is designed, which can offer high throughput. Sub-frame-level parallelism and trellis state-level parallelism have been implemented by some researchers. In this paper, we propose a new method to accelerate our decoder: sub-decoder-level parallelism. In addition, shared memory is utilized to keep memory access fast. Finally, the bit error rate (BER) performance and throughput of the decoder are presented.
  • Keywords
    Long Term Evolution; channel capacity; convolutional codes; error statistics; graphics processing units; turbo codes; 3GPP LTE turbo decoder; BER; Claude Berrou; GPU; Long Term Evolution; SDR; Viterbi algorithm; bit error rate; channel capacity; convolutional codes; graphics processing units; memory access; software defined radio; sub-frame-level parallelism; trellis state-level parallelism; turbo codes; Bit error rate; Decoding; Graphics processing units; Instruction sets; Iterative decoding; Parallel processing; Throughput; GPU; Parallel computing; Turbo decoding;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Communication Technology (ICCT), 2013 15th IEEE International Conference on
  • Conference_Location
    Guilin
  • Type

    conf

  • DOI
    10.1109/ICCT.2013.6820447
  • Filename
    6820447